ESP32:揭秘物联网时代的“全能战士”

在物联网时代,各种智能设备层出不穷,而作为核心的微控制器(MCU)在其中扮演着至关重要的角色。ESP32,作为一款高性能、低功耗的Wi-Fi+蓝牙双模MCU,凭借其强大的功能和出色的性价比,已经成为众多开发者和企业青睐的对象。本文将深入剖析ESP32的特性和应用,带你领略这款物联网“全能战士”的魅力。
一、ESP32的诞生背景
随着物联网技术的飞速发展,对微控制器的性能要求越来越高。传统的MCU在处理复杂任务时,往往会出现功耗高、速度慢等问题。为了满足市场需求,乐鑫信息科技(上海)有限公司(以下简称“乐鑫”)推出了ESP32这款高性能、低功耗的Wi-Fi+蓝牙双模MCU。
二、ESP32的核心特性
1. 高性能
ESP32采用Tensilica Xtensa LX7微架构,主频可达240MHz,运行速度快,处理能力强。此外,ESP32还支持双核处理,使得多任务处理更加流畅。
2. 低功耗
ESP32在低功耗模式下,待机电流仅为5uA,有效降低了设备功耗,延长了电池寿命。
3. Wi-Fi+蓝牙双模
ESP32支持Wi-Fi 4(802.11n)和蓝牙5.0,可以实现高速无线连接,满足各种物联网应用需求。
4. 丰富的接口
ESP32拥有丰富的接口,包括GPIO、UART、SPI、I2C、I2S、PWM等,方便开发者进行扩展和定制。
5. 内置存储
ESP32内置4MB SPI Flash,支持外部扩展,满足不同存储需求。
6. 物联网安全
ESP32支持多种安全协议,如TLS 1.2、SSL、WPA2等,确保数据传输的安全性。
三、ESP32的应用领域
1. 智能家居
ESP32在智能家居领域有着广泛的应用,如智能灯泡、智能插座、智能门锁等。通过Wi-Fi和蓝牙连接,实现设备间的互联互通,为用户提供便捷、舒适的家居生活。
2. 可穿戴设备
ESP32的低功耗特性使其成为可穿戴设备的理想选择。如智能手表、智能手环等,通过蓝牙连接手机,实现健康数据监测、消息提醒等功能。
3. 工业物联网
ESP32在工业物联网领域也有着广泛的应用,如智能传感器、智能控制器等。通过Wi-Fi和蓝牙连接,实现设备间的数据采集、传输和控制,提高生产效率。
4. 智能交通
ESP32在智能交通领域也有着重要的应用,如智能停车、智能交通信号灯等。通过Wi-Fi和蓝牙连接,实现车辆、道路和交通设施的智能化管理。
5. 农业物联网
ESP32在农业物联网领域也有着广泛的应用,如智能灌溉、智能温室等。通过Wi-Fi和蓝牙连接,实现农作物生长环境的实时监测和智能控制。
四、总结
ESP32作为一款高性能、低功耗的Wi-Fi+蓝牙双模MCU,凭借其强大的功能和出色的性价比,已经成为物联网时代的“全能战士”。在智能家居、可穿戴设备、工业物联网、智能交通和农业物联网等领域,ESP32都展现出了巨大的应用潜力。随着物联网技术的不断发展,相信ESP32将会在更多领域发挥重要作用。






